What suburb design principles affect the layout around 4 Weaver Place?

Charnwood was originally planned using the Radburn principle, where streets serve rear garages and houses were intended to face common parkland. In practice many homes now have fences around the park side, creating narrow walkways.

What geological features are characteristic of the Charnwood area?

Charnwood sits on Silurian‑age rocks, mainly Deakin Volcanics purple rhyodacite, with the Deakin Fault along its north‑east edge and Hawkins Volcanics green‑grey dacite in the north‑east beyond the fault.

What community events have historically taken place in Charnwood?

From 2004 to 2018 Charnwood hosted the annual "Charny Carny" carnival, supporting local schools and the Mount Rogers Scout Group; the event ceased in 2020 due to a shortage of volunteers.
